Stream Chemistry for Reactivated Channel

Summary

Abstract: 

Data corresponds to the chemistry measurements taken on the reactivated channel, mostly inorganic compounds

Date Range: 

January 1, 1996 to December 31, 2000
Data Citation
Lyons, W., Mcknight, D.M. 2015. Stream Chemistry for Reactivated Channel. Environmental Data Initiative. DOI: 10.6073/pasta/ed143e49e82d0aaa1494447ebcee17c1. Dataset accessed 28 March 2024.
